Stage Tenders (Page 134)
481 matching tenders. Page 134 of 17.
Explore current and recent UK tenders related to Stage.
Open opportunities
No visible tenders found for this hub page.
481 matching tenders. Page 134 of 17.
Explore current and recent UK tenders related to Stage.
No visible tenders found for this hub page.